Título:
Modafinil enhances thalamocortical activity by increasing neuronal electrotoic coupling

Resumen:
Modafinil (Provigil, Modiodal), an antinarcoleptic and moodenhancing drug, is shown here to sharpen thalamocortical activity and to increase electrical coupling between cortical interneurons and between nerve cells in the inferior olivary nucleus. Alter irreversible pharmacological block of connexin permeability (i.e., by using either 18-beta-glycyrrhetinic derivatives or mefloquine), modafinil restored electrotonic coupling within 30 min. It was further established that this restoration is implemented through a Ca2+/calmodulin protein kinase II-dependent step.
